Origins of the Surname

The surname Trivunović has roots in the Serbian language and can be traced back to the given name Trivun. Trivun is a traditional Serbian name that has historical significance and is believed to have originated from the pre-Christian era. The suffix -ović is a common patronymic ending in Serbian surnames, indicating "son of." Therefore, Trivunović translates to "son of Trivun."

Regional Distribution

The surname Trivunović is predominantly found in Serbia, with a high incidencia of 1309, indicating its popularity and prevalence within the country. It is also present in significant numbers in Bosnia and Herzegovina, Croatia, and Slovenia, with incidencias of 815, 401, and 116 respectively.
